jplusplus / detective.io

Detective.io is a platform that hosts your investigation and lets you make powerful queries to mine it. Simply describe your field of study and detective.io builds the input interface as well as a state-of-the-art front-end.
http://www.detective.io
GNU Lesser General Public License v3.0
139 stars 17 forks source link

Documenter l'API #127

Open pirhoo opened 10 years ago

pirhoo commented 10 years ago

Va falloir faire remonter un peu cette issue. Est ce que vous avez une préférence et/ou une recommandation pour documenter l'API ? Ping @Paulloz @pbellon @vied12.

Sur un projet précédent on avait essayé d'utiliser Swagger sur Tastypie, c'est plutôt bien fait mais assez limité : https://github.com/concentricsky/django-tastypie-swagger

Habituellement en python utilise Sphinx, je sais pas si c'est adapté pour une API : http://sphinx-doc.org/

paulloz commented 10 years ago

Jamais utilisé autre chose que Sphinx pour écrire de la doc Python perso'.
Après faut déjà savoir si on veut de la doc générée ou pas...

pirhoo commented 10 years ago

Il y a aussi Tastytools qui permet de générer de la doc pour Tastypie : https://github.com/juanique/django-tastytools

pirhoo commented 10 years ago

Y'a de l'autodoc sur Sphinx, c'est cool.